"Dining Table Louis Philippe Demi-lune With 8 Extensions"
Mahogany half moon shaped dining table with 7 legs on casters. 
 
8 extensions for a total width of 426 cm 
 
Napoleon III period 
 
Very good condition of the varnish.  
 
DELIVERY IN FRANCE 189€.

WORLD DELIVERY ON ESTIMATE
 
Unusual dimensions for a depth of 160 cm
